Great except the CVT noise
Love everything about my 2019 Platinum except the way the engine makes a bog-down rumbling noise when the tachometer hovers at the 1K mark. My 2012 Maxima CVT did not do this. It's quite noticeable anytime I have to slow down or just do around town driving and the tach hits 1K. Horrible experience that many others discuss online in the owners' forums. Otherwise, I love the cargo room, the Bose stereo, the padded seats and the convenience and safety features.

love the car, hate the problems at under 16000 mil
Only 16000 miles on it. Had trouble with radio, software fix, hath back seat d trouble with seat going down when pull releas latch at 2000 miles, had to have broken plastic piece replaced. 1 engine mount had collapsed, when took in for radio repair. Had to have that replaced. All was under warranty.

How much does the 2019 Nissan Murano cost?
The 2019 Nissan Murano price depends on several factors, including the trim level, optional features, mileage, vehicle history and location. The nationwide average price for a 2019 Murano is $19,373, with pricing starting at $11,668.
What is the MPG of the 2019 Nissan Murano?
The 2019 Nissan Murano offers up to 20 MPG in city driving and 28 MPG on the highway for a combined rating of 23 MPG.
These figures are based on EPA mileage ratings and are for comparison purposes only. The actual mileage will vary depending on the selected vehicle trim, driving conditions, driving habits, vehicle maintenance, and other factors.
